Respiratory decline in adult patients with Becker muscular dystrophy: a longitudinal study

Becker muscular dystrophy (BMD) is a rare hereditary neuromuscular disease, caused by a genetic defect in the Duchenne Muscular Dystrophy (DMD) gene. We studied the natural history of respiratory function and its affecting factors in 23 adult BMD patients. These important data are needed for (future) clinical trials in BMD but are largely lacking. Patients had a median age of 51 years (28-78y) and median follow-up duration of 14 years (2-25y). We analysed 190 pulmonary function measurements with a median interval of one year (1-17y) and measured a 1.00% decline of Forced Vital Capacity percent predicted (FVC%pred) per year (p = 0.004). Loss of ambulation significantly increased the annual rate of FVC decline and was dependent of patient's body mass index (BMI; p = 0.015), with increases in BMI correlating with an even more rapid deterioration of FVC. A decline in Medical Research Council (MRC) sum score was significantly correlated with a decline in FVC (p = 0.003). We conclude that adult BMD patients experience a significant but mild respiratory decline. However, this decline is significantly more rapid and clinically relevant after loss of ambulation, which warrants a more vigilant follow-up of respiratory function in this subgroup.

成人贝克肌营养不良症患者呼吸功能下降:一项纵向研究

贝克肌营养不良症(BMD)是一种罕见的遗传性神经肌肉疾病,由杜氏肌营养不良症(DMD)基因的遗传缺陷引起。我们研究了 23 名成年 BMD 患者的呼吸功能自然史及其影响因素。这些重要数据是(未来)BMD 临床试验所需要的,但在很大程度上缺乏。患者的中位年龄为 51 岁(28-78 岁),中位随访时间为 14 年(2-25 岁)。我们分析了 190 次肺功能测量值,中位间隔为一年 (1-17 年),并测量了强迫肺活量预测百分比 (FVC%pred) 每年下降 1.00% (p = 0.004)。不能走动显着增加了 FVC 的年下降率,并且取决于患者的体重指数 (BMI; p = 0.015),BMI 的增加与 FVC 的更快恶化相关。医学研究委员会 (MRC) 总分的下降与 FVC 的下降显着相关 (p = 0.003)。我们得出结论,成年 BMD 患者经历了显着但轻微的呼吸下降。然而,这种下降在失去行走能力后明显更快且具有临床意义,因此需要对该亚组的呼吸功能进行更加警惕的随访。
